CJ Ham named 2015 NSIC Football Glen Galligan Award Recipient

BURNSVILLE, Minn. – Augustana University senior running back CJ Ham was voted by the NSIC football coaches as the 2015 NSIC Glen Galligan Award recipient. The award is given to a student-athlete who participates at his institution for four years and is academically superior while making a positive contribution to the institution.
 
The Galligan Award was initiated in 1948 to honor an outstanding senior football player in the NSIC. Glen Galligan was the athletics director at Winona State University from 1929-47 and head football coach from 1927-23 and 1935.
 
Ham is a two-sport athlete at Augustana as he is a four-year letterwinner in football and track and field. An All-NSIC Second Team selection at running back in 2015, Ham is also a two-time All-NSIC honoree in the shot put. He currently holds the school record in the indoor weight throw and the outdoor hammer throw. He has helped Augustana football to its first playoff appearance since 2010 this season finishing the regular season with 1,043 rushing yards and 15 rushing touchdowns. He enters the postseason one rushing touchdown and 71 yards shy of single season records at Augustana after becoming just the fourth back in program history to rush for 1,000-plus yards in a season last weekend. In his career, Ham has rushed for 2,608 yards and 28 touchdowns.
 
Ham has been an incredible leader and mentor during his career at Augustana and will continue on that path in the future. He is a physical education and health major at Augustana and plans on teaching and coaching football and track and field. Since his freshman season, Ham has volunteered as a peer educator and mentor in the Sioux Falls School District and has volunteered weekly at the Boys and Girls Club.
 
"I am so pleased that CJ was voted the recipient of this great honor," head football coach Jerry Olszewski said. "CJ represents all that this award is about in achievement, character and leadership. He is one of the very finest young men and competitors that I have ever coached. As his coach, I have been blessed to watch him grow into the player and man that he is today."
 
A leader and member of Augustana's Fellowship of Christian Athletes, Ham has also spent time as a student engagement volunteer at Embrace Church. He has also volunteered as a speaker in advocacy groups for children with disabilities. Ham has overcome a speech disorder that has affected him his entire life and he has used that as a platform to show kids if they believe in themselves they can be successful in life. Ham has also served on numerous projects with Habitat for Humanity with the Augustana football program during his career.
 
Ham is the second Viking to be named the recipient of the Glen Galligan Award since Augustana joined the NSIC in 2008. Dan Schoen was named the recipient of the Glen Galligan Award in 2010.
 
Located in Sioux Falls, S.D., Augustana University is a member of NCAA Division II and competes in the Northern Sun Intercollegiate Conference.
